Our Canine
We have now a various group of rescued canine who come collectively to be a really welcoming, tight-knit canine household.
Susie
The primary on this group was Susie, who was a type of all-around good canine. She liked everybody, and everybody liked her. She set the tone of kindness in our canine, and it has carried via to each new canine that has been added, even since Susie’s been gone.
Piglet
After all, Piglet is the star—deaf blind and systematic in his method to every little thing he does.
He’s a detail-oriented canine, which is what makes him such a very good educating mannequin for youngsters and adults. Piglet makes use of his senses of scent and contact to navigate his world. When he enters a brand new surroundings, he’s pushed to discover and be taught boundaries, obstacles, who’s there, and the place dinner can be served, whether or not that is in a resort room or an Airbnb.
Recording him in motion supplies wonderful sources for educators to deliver Piglet’s message of positivity and kindness to life for his or her college students.
He is a really quirky little man. He loves his dad, Warren, who we name Piglet’s Favourite Dad. He has BFF girlfriends on the vet hospital the place I work, and he likes to do his faucet sign demos throughout our college visits.

The Challenges
One of many greatest challenges I’ve confronted as a pet proprietor is saying no to extra canine that want a house.
One other problem has been watching our lovely pack change.
Fourteen or fifteen years in the past, we adopted 4 canine in lower than two years. All 4 of these canine had a blast collectively once they have been younger and loved one another via each part of their lives. They grew outdated collectively and continued their friendship into their senior years.
The issue got here on the very finish as we began to lose the older canine.
The losses for me are magnified by having to look at our lovely pack change. Every canine that leaves is missed by all the opposite canine, which provides an entire new dimension to my grief.
One other problem is deciding on canine so as to add to our pack—assessing whether or not or not they are going to be a very good match for the present group. Even the nicest canine should not essentially going to work out. Pack dynamics are sophisticated.
We have now been very fortunate, however we needed to rehome an exquisite, candy deaf Australian Shepherd pet final summer time as a result of mismatch between her high-energy character and bodily measurement versus our very small older canine.

What I’ve Discovered
When contemplating including a brand new pet to your loved ones, be sure you be taught all there’s to find out about that individual species and the necessities for care. Discovering the precise species, and ensuring the match is true for any particular person you might be contemplating adopting.
Issues embody the species, measurement, age, temperament, how they get together with youngsters and different pets, and disabilities which may affect care necessities. Then it’s good to issue in your house surroundings, different pets, youngsters, your work and journey schedule, and the price of veterinary care.
Placing every little thing collectively will lead you in a basic route. Then begin checking with rescues to search out “the one” who you join with.
It is also crucial to have a very good, trusting relationship together with your veterinarian. Convey your pets to the vet for yearly checkups and routine care in order that they know you and your pet. Then, if and when there’s a problem, you might be all aware of one another, which results in essentially the most optimum care on your pets.
